# Break-Glass: Catalog Cache Invalidation

Scope: the Pinrow product catalog at Veldstone Retail. If stale prices persist after a purge and the Hollowmere invalidation queue is wedged, use break-glass to flush the edge tier directly. Contractors: get verbal sign-off from the catalog lead first. Steps: open the Hollowmere admin shell, select emergency-flush, confirm the tenant, and run it once — repeated flushes thrash the origin. Access is logged and expires after 20 minutes. Unseal the admin shell with the passphrase below.

recovery phrase for kahop-tajog: istix-casvan

Welcome, plugin authors!

If your plugin touches image uploads on Pixelgrove, you must run them through our EXIF scrubber, Scrubbin, before storage — no GPS coords or camera serials should ever hit disk. The sandbox gives you a pre-wired Scrubbin client; just call `scrub()` and move on. To unlock the sandbox's test-asset vault on first run, enter the recovery passphrase printed below.

strongbox words: prawyn-fenmir

# Cold Storage Archival — notes for the weekly eng sync (Team Permafrost)
# This config governs the nightly sweep that moves buckets untouched for 180+
# days from the Tarnwell hot tier into Glacierpoint cold storage. Please review
# ARCHIVE_BATCH_SIZE carefully before changing it; batches over 500 objects
# have caused manifest timeouts twice this quarter. Restores must go through
# the ops queue, never directly. The sweep job authenticates to the
# Glacierpoint API with the key declared on the next line.

secret setting of kagug-tajep: COURIER_KEY8=e81a8675

## Fan-out Backpressure

Pushfield fans notifications out to device channels via Quillfeather workers. When downstream queues exceed the high-water mark, producers throttle automatically; do not disable this manually. Symptoms of saturation: rising publish latency, shed low-priority batches. First response: check worker pool health, then queue depth. Full backpressure tuning guidance is on the internal engineering page.

wiki page, hahog-yahog: https://jira.plorvaworks.corp/display/dash/pages/pages/repo/display/spaces/7b9c5df2c5490ad9694860b5